Dad's Silver Tree and White Dove

We also bought at Marshall's a little silver tree for Dad. The dove we had matched so well. Dad instilled one thing in me and that was the "true" excitement of Christmas. The "waiting" and "hoping" for the one big gift once a year was so special. We would get the Western Auto Toy Catalog and pick out what we wanted. Mom and Dad would go to Western Auto and layed away all our toys in Nov. then they would charge them on a store account and have to pay on them the rest of the year! I will always remember Dad trying to sneak a huge box of toys into the house (never worked because with 6 kids there was always several or all of us lurking about the house) Barbara's job when she was a young teenager was to make the rest of us kids think Santa had actually delivered our gifts right down to tracking snow in the house and telling us it was Santa Claus who tracked it in! Our Family Christmas's were the BEST! because of such loving and caring parents.
